Da Hong Summer is slightly denser than other purple pak choi, former a more developed head, and firmer petioles. Leaf color is Dark violet-red with green petiole color It's heat tolerance is higher than many other pak choi, and it can also weather greater temperature fluctuations between day and night without bolting.
- Cool season annual
- Approx. 200 seeds in packet. (A seed will vary in weight and size within a given seed lot. The number of seeds stated is only an estimate.)
- Maturity: Approx. 20-25 days for baby leaf, 45-55 days to maturity
- Planting season: Spring/late summer-early fall

Cultivation: Prepare fertile, well-drained soil. Sow seeds in spring after last frost or late summer/early fall in a sunny location. Keep soil moist. Fertilize as needed. Mulch fall crops to help avoid premature bolting. Most vegetables leave having purple color is called “anthocyan” which is generally developed by lower temperature. Growing temperatures 50-60°F should be adequate to develop “anthocyan” after the seeds have germinated. We cannot tell exactly how long exposure should be under low temperatures. The grower should trial different methods and observe how the plant reacts.
